NFRC rating system and labeling system for energy performance windows doors, skylights and attachment products

The National Fenestration Rating Council (NFRC) is a non-profit organization that operates a uniform and independent labeling system to measure the energy performance of doors, windows skylights, skylights and other attachement products. This label helps consumers make informed choices regarding energy-efficient products.

Energy ratings complement other NFRC labels, such as structural performance and air quality ratings. These ratings are useful in determining the energy efficiency of a building.

A window is rated according to the U-factor and R-value. The U-factor represents the product's insulation value and the R-value is the insulation value of other components within the building envelope.

Certain energy ratings are based on computer simulations, while others are determined by actual measurements of solar heat gain. Either way, you can determine the appropriateness of a product for your home.

Although most window ratings share the same characteristics, they can vary between different areas. This is due to the need to adjust to the latest technologies.

Apart from determining the insulative value of the window, the ratings also evaluate the performance of the weatherstripping, sealants, and insulating glass units. They also measure visible light transmittance.

NFRC labels are available for many regions and can provide more information about a product than R-value or U-factor. They offer ratings for Solar Heat Gain Coefficient Visible Light Transmittance, Air Leakage, Condensation Resistance and more.

The NFRC website provides comprehensive information on the process of obtaining its certification. You can download free fact sheets on NFRC and find out more about the council.

The NFRC-certified products are independently tested and certified by an outside party. The certification process includes an independent review of the design, manufacture, and participation in the NFRC rating system and labeling system.

Many companies involved in the field of fenestration are members of the NFRC. The organization was established in response to the energy crisis of the 1970s. Today, NFRC includes government agencies research, manufacturers, and manufacturers as well as suppliers. The NFRC's ratings are used in all major energy efficiency programmes.

Consumers can find out more about the NFRC labeling system via the NFRC website. Apart from providing energy performance ratings, the labels also provide information on the manufacturer of the product.
